Kuwait Municipality completes studies for Jahra Waterfront Project

Kuwait Municipality confirmed on Wednesday that all studies related to the Jahra Waterfront project have been completed by specialized firms with international expertise.

Deputy Director General for Projects, Maysa Boushehri, stated in a press release that the municipality recently held a preliminary meeting for the project to clarify the scope of work, participation requirements, and to answer inquiries from stakeholders.

This approach reinforces the principles of transparency and equal opportunity for all participating companies.

Boushehri explained that the preliminary meeting is part of the municipality’s efforts to streamline tendering procedures and enhance clarity regarding technical and contractual requirements for all participants.

She emphasized that the Jahra Waterfront project reflects Kuwait Municipality’s commitment to delivering initiatives that have undergone thorough studies conducted by internationally experienced firms.

She further noted that the project is the largest currently tendered by the municipality and is designed to provide sports, recreational, and commercial facilities for residents of the northern regions, which are experiencing rapid growth.

The project aims to offer these services in line with the latest international best practices.
